Sucuri offers a free WordPress plugin for integrity checks, malware detection, and security logging, plus a paid website firewall and cleanup service. - Source: dev.to / 7 months ago

I recently came across SlickStrack, which is a utility for setting up WordPress on Ubuntu LTS. It sets it up with Nginx and some other configs, by which it attempts to enforce some best practices with regards to speed and security. Source: over 4 years ago
